Guangdong Guangqing Metal Technology Co Ltd is a steel plant in China with a reported capacity of 2,000,000 t of steel. It produces crude steel from iron ore (blast furnace) or scrap (electric arc furnace). It is operated by Guangdong Guangqing METAL Technology Co Ltd. By capacity it ranks #171 of 363 steel plants tracked in China. It emits about 416,359 tonnes of CO₂e per year (Climate TRACE) — roughly the tailpipe emissions of 97,053 cars. Its CO₂ per unit of capacity is about 61% below the median steel plant.
